#860DBC Hex color
The hexadecimal color code #860DBC corresponds to the code RGB( 134, 13, 188 ). It's a shade of Purple. This color is a combination of red (at 0,53 level), green (at 0,05 level) and blue (at 0,74 level). Its brightness is 39% and its saturation is 87%. It is composed of red at 40%, green at 3% and blue at 56%.

Uses of #860DBC in CSS
When using #860DBC as the background color, consider selecting a lighter text color for improved readability. If you want to use #860DBC as the text color, prefer a light background, such as Blanc.
#860DBC as background color
div{ background: #860DBC; }
Colored text
div{ color: #860DBC; }
Border
div{ border: 3px solid #860DBC; }
Shadow
div{ box-shadow: 3px 3px 7px #860DBC; }
